JOB SUMMARY

  • Assisting with strategic planning including the development and production of strategic plans, management reviews, performance updates and associated research, analysis, and presentation
  • Facilitating and execution of the revamped Transformation, Technology & Operations (TTO) organisation strategy & change management initiative
  • Supporting discussions and decisionmaking at various forums / committees attended by CTOO
  • Support CTOO in identifying, designing & implementation of continuous improvement opportunities in every aspect of our business constant adaptation to clients' changing needs; focus on efficiency and productivity; and ongoing investments in our core capabilities.
  • Support CTOO to innovate existing business model by linking market changes back to operations, drive crossbank collaboration and enhance client experience for client growth and higher returns
  • Support CTOO to oversee efficient and prioritise delivery of investment portfolio
  • Enable our operational capability in a manner than we are constantly listening to our clients, and then continuously testing, enhancing, and personalizing the client experience.
  • Support CTOO in enabling a culture where operations function leads an adoption focused mindset on optimizing and automating business processes, particularly with the needs of our clients in mind as they try to forecast their business and foresee the environment in which they operate

RESPONSIBILITIES

Strategy

  • As Program Manager identify, design, and deliver initiatives that will contribute to the execution of the revamped TTO strategy & organisation design
  • Ensure the design and delivery of initiatives are consistent with the business & functional strategy where appropriate
  • Bring significant technology & understanding of agile methodologies, ways of working acumen to bear in the design and implementation of transformation & change initiatives.
  • Engage deeply with internal & external stakeholders where appropriate to ensure all change initiatives are reflective of business and industry requirements and fit for purpose in delivering our aspiration as a Technology and Operations function.

Business Processes

  • Lead, develop, implement and track business initiatives / projects on behalf of CTOO
  • Liaising with business (Commercial & CIB, PvB, Wealth Management, Retail & functional teams viz Technology, Finance, Risk, Compliance, Legal, HR as appropriate) across the bank, support the design, review, and rollout of Operations scorecards. including the assessment of relevant / applicable metrics, and the coordination of the target setting process for business and individual scorecards.
  • Support CTOO in managing & delivering of cost budgets for the team
  • Provide input to the development of endtoend scalable infrastructure and processes to execute business processes.

People & Talent

  • Lead through example and help build the appropriate culture and values across the Operations function
  • Support CTOO in executing his SMR responsibilities including Reasonable steps through regular review, facilitate in adequate documentation of decisionmaking process. Continuously engage with SMR Compliance team for advisory & inputs.

Example:
Regular review of Job description to reflect delegation of appropriate authority, actions as appropriate


Risk Management and Governance

  • Prepare reports, presentations, papers, and review material to support discussions and decision making at various forums, mainly for RMT/CMT, CTOO MT, Board Committees, Risk Committees etc,. This will involve consolidating and integrating material from various sources and ensuring the final output is fit for purpose and aligned with CTOO requirements
  • Continuously improve business management efficiency by simplifying and standardizing operational processes and procedures. Identify and implement best practices in resources and processes, ensuring consistency and relevancy.
  • Work with business and infrastructure stakeholders to identify and prioritise enhancements where applicable, and associated business cases and investments.
  • Coordinate and support business engagements or adhoc requirements with other teams / partners in the Bank and external parties (i.e. consultants, vendors, auditors, regulators, clients, media/publications, etc).
  • Coordinate business meetings and escalations with stakeholders and support functions as required on behalf of CTOO
